•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

makro yenı sayfa adlandırma makrosu

  • Konbuyu başlatan Konbuyu başlatan burackx
  • Başlangıç tarihi Başlangıç tarihi
Katılım
25 Temmuz 2011
Mesajlar
4
Excel Vers. ve Dili
2003 ing
merhabalar. yapmıs olacagımız bır makro dugmesı ıle yenı calısma sayfası ekleyecek ve bu sayfaya sıralı olarak kw 1,kw 2, kw3 ekleyecek.her hafta basılcak ve 1 sayfa soluna 1 ust numarayı ekleyecek.örn kw 6 var basınca bu sayfanın yanına kw 7 calısma sayfası ekleyecek ve formatları aynı olacak, ofis 2003 kullanıyorum yardımlarınız ıcın tesekkurler
 

Ekli dosyalar

Merhaba,

Aşağıdaki kodları ThisWorkbook'un sayfasına kopyalayıp deneyiniz.

Herhangi bir sayfada herhangi bir hücreye çift tıkladığınızda KW ile başlayan sayfayı açacaktır.

Kod:
Private Sub Workbook_SheetBeforeDoubleClick(ByVal Sh As Object, ByVal Target As Range, Cancel As Boolean)
 
    Dim YesNo   As String
    Dim i       As Integer
    Dim j       As Integer
    Dim No      As Integer
    Dim Sayfa   As String
 
    Sayfa = ActiveSheet.Name
 
    For i = 1 To Sheets.Count
        If Sheets(i).Name Like "KW *" Then
            No = Split(Sheets(i).Name, " ")(1)
            If No > j Then j = No
        End If
    Next i
 
    j = j + 1
 
    YesNo = MsgBox("KW " & j & " Sayfasını Açmak İstiyor musunuz?", vbYesNo, "SAYFA AÇMA")
 
    If YesNo = vbYes Then
        Sheets.Add After:=Sheets(Sheets.Count)
        ActiveSheet.Name = "KW " & j
        Sheets(Sayfa).Select
    Else
        MsgBox "Sayfa Açmaktan Vazgeçtiniz...."
    End If
 
End Sub
 
Geri
Üst